    I fundamentally disagree with Mike, and even his explanation doesn't make sense if you think about it. He says: "It is a tool that will assist people so that they are more efficient", i.e. it is a productivity tool that will enable users to do more, faster. So if today you need 30 cloud engineers to do the work but AI makes each of them 2x as efficient then you only need 15 engineers to do the same workload...so why keep all 30? It won't completely replace professional workers, you still need people who know what they're doing to double check what the AI created, but it will reduce the number of professional workers needed to do any given amount of work.
    There are those that will say: "That just means they'll get more work done!" but businesses don't create workloads for cloud engineers for no reason, there is always a business priority that is driving that work and those priorities don't magically change just because workers are suddenly more efficient.
    There is going to be an impact on the professional labor markets generally over the next 5-10 years as this technology improves and becomes more ubiquitous, likely increasing competition for fewer jobs and thus lowering salaries.
